Job description

We're looking for a Sound & AV Engineer to join a research team working on next-generation AR/VR. You'll be based in a world-class acoustic lab, setting up kit, capturing high-quality audio and video, and supporting researchers on cutting-edge projects.

The Offer:

Annual Salary up to £70,000 doe 12-month contract - inside IR35 - PAYE + possibility of extension

Location: Cambridge - Fully onsite

Access to one of the most advanced audio labs in the world

The Role:
  • Set up, test, and calibrate microphones, speakers, audio interfaces, and recording systems
  • Capture high-quality audio/video data in a controlled lab environment
  • Process and validate recordings to ensure accuracy and consistency
  • Work closely with engineers and volunteers during data collection sessions
What We'RE Looking For:
  • 2-4 years' experience in audio, acoustics, or AV engineering roles (lab, R&D, test, or similar)
  • Strong hands-on experience with microphones, DAWs (Logic, Pro Tools), and audio interfaces
  • A methodical approach with excellent attention to detail
  • Clear communication skills and the ability to work well in a collaborative lab setting
  • Nice to have: Python, Linux/command line or database experience
